Hi all,

We also have the same error (unable to internalize message, No parts
found in Multipart
InputStream) using a different adapter: Lexicom (Cleo).

We found that the Content-type start parameter value doesn't exactly
match the content-id value: The < and > symbols are not present in the
content-id. Example:

Request content-type value:
multipart/related; type="text/xml"; boundary="--------
CLEOebXML.Boundary.1253712627668.yradnuoB.LMXbeOELC--------";
start=SOAP

First lines of request body:
----------CLEOebXML.Boundary.1253712627668.yradnuoB.LMXbeOELC--------
Content-Id: <SOAP>
Content-Type: text/xml


We think Lexicom doesn't follow RFC 2387 because the content-id and
start parameter should match exactly.

We have also checked the EbMS v2.0 specification and it contains the
following example in section 2.1.2 message package:
Content-Type: multipart/related; type="text/xml";
boundary="boundaryValue";
start=messagepackage-123@example.com

--boundaryValue
Content-ID: <messagepackage-123@example.com>


Here the start and content-id parameters also do not match. We
believe this is a mistake in the EbMS specifications. Further in
Appendix B there is an example where the start and content-id do match
exactly.

We are awaiting clarification from the vendor of Lexicom (Cleo).
